Students Affairs Unit

The Student Affairs Unit is the unit responsible for dealing with college’s students. It provides support services such as registration services and information on the student’s academic status. It is the link between the college and its students ,  with the Deanship of Admission and Registration, and with the Deanship of Student Affairs and the relevant university agencies. The unit plays an important role in assisting students expected to graduate and providing them with the needed assistance to complete their procedures easily.

The unit functions under the Vice dean for Academic Affairs.

Responsibilities:

  1. Receiving admission files, sorting them, completing the required data, reviewing and checking them, ensuring that they comply with the admission criteria and then  referring them to the interviewing committee.
  2. Setting registration plan at the beginning of each semester and announcing it to the students.
  3. Addressing the registration issues that students face students at the beginning of each semester and adjusting their schedules to the student’s interest within the limits of the regulations.
  4. Preparing of schedules on the student information system (SIS)and the learning management syste(LMS).
  5. Registering students’ schedule, ensuring the students’ academic achievement in accordance with the study plan and preparing relevant reports.
  6. Follow up on students’ academic cases.
  7. Informing students of cases of warning, deprivation and other decisions, and following up on that with the relevant committees.
  8. Managing the attendance and absence of students and following up on related procedures.
  9. Assisting graduates in completing their graduation procedures.
  10. Assisting students expected to graduate in registering the remaining subjects for them and referring their applications to the Deanship of Admission and Registration at the university and follow up on that.
  11. Follow up on the reservation of classrooms and modify them if necessary.
  12. Receiving students’ requests regarding course equivalency, reviewing them and ensuring that they meet the requirements, presenting them to the committee and following up on these requests within the college. After obtaining approval, the applications are sent to the Deanship of Admission and Registration for approval and execution.
  13. Receiving applications referred from the Deanship of the College regarding alternative exams and follow up with the various departments.
  14. Proposal updates to the college management regarding internal regulations.
  15. Receiving new students at the college and providing them with advice and guidance to enable them to pass the first steps in the college.
  16. Assisting students in issuing college identification cards.
  17. Follow up on absences and medical excuses
  18. Checking the lists of deprivation and coordinating with the college  deanship regarding students deprived of sitting for exams.
  19. Communicate with departments to determine and confirm lists of course coordinators
